Deck staining in Virginia Beach requires a process that accounts for the unique environmental pressures of coastal living. The salt-laden air, high humidity, and intense summer sun can quickly degrade untreated wood, leading to graying, warping, and rot. A professional deck staining job begins with a thorough cleaning using a wood-specific cleaner and a pressure washer set to a low enough pressure to avoid damaging the grain. After the deck dries completelyβtypically 24 to 48 hours depending on the weatherβany damaged or splintered boards are replaced or sanded down. The stain is then applied using a combination of brushes, rollers, and sprayers to ensure even coverage into every crack and crevice. For Virginia Beach properties, a semi-transparent or solid stain with UV blockers and mildewcides is recommended to protect against fading and fungal growth. The entire process, from prep to final coat, usually takes two to three days for an average-sized deck, allowing for drying time between coats. This attention to detail ensures that your deck not only looks refreshed but also withstands the elements for years to come, reducing the need for frequent reapplication.
Why does this matter specifically for Virginia Beach? The constant exposure to moisture from rain and ocean mist means that decks here are more prone to moisture-related issues like cupping, cracking, and mold than decks in drier climates. Proper staining seals the wood, preventing water from penetrating the surface while still allowing the wood to breathe. Without this protection, a deck can begin to show wear within a single season. By choosing a stain with a high solids content and a matte or satin finish, you get a durable barrier that resists peeling and blistering even under the midday sun. The result is a deck that remains safe for bare feet, resistant to splinters, and visually consistent with the coastal aesthetic of your home.
